We are back for good, says Styl-Plus


A few years back, at whatever point the trio of Shiffi Emoefe, Tunde Akinsanmi and Zeal Onyecheme of RnB gathering, Styl-Plus, performed at shows, it was ensured that one would discover brassieres and underwear littering the floor of whatever scene was used. The clothing would have been tossed by their energized female fans who might shout as loud as possible in valuation for the capable vocalists. Those were the days when Styl-Plus' nearness at a show was a certification that gathering goers were in for a decent time. 

Be that as it may, after some time, they appeared to fail out like candles in the wind and nothing was
gotten notification from them any longer. 

Much the same as nature, the Nigerian music industry severely dislikes a vacuum so fans proceeded onward and discovered different artistes to alleviate their hunger. 

Styl-Plus attempted to make a few rebounds throughout the years yet their endeavors have been to a great extent unsuccessful. 

In any case, the trio has now turned into a team, with one of them, Tunde, having left the gathering to seek after different interests. 

The new Styl-Plus is back with another tune, Aso Ibora and they are advising any individual who considerations to listen that, this time, they wouldn't leave so quick. 

Conversing with Sunday Scoop, the twosome stated, "Yes, we have been away for quite a while, yet confide in me, we are back for good. We have backpedaled to the planning phase to concentrate the sort of sound that fans truly need as of now and we are prepared for them." 

On the motivation for their new melody, Aso Ibora (which actually means cover), Zeal stated, "The single is essentially the tale of a regular individual who is energetic about the affection appeared to him/her. It is additionally a message to Styl-Plus fans to express gratitude toward them for their support as the years progressed." 

Shiffi included, "Styl-Plus is known for our one of a kind love tunes and this new melody is keeping with that custom. We need our fans to realize that we are still those artists that they cherish, just that we are far and away superior this time. Throughout the years, we have been getting input from our fans that they miss us and we truly miss them as well. We say thanks to them for their faithfulness and we wouldn't frustrate them." 

Reacting to a question on why Tunde is no longer with them, Shiffi waxed philosophical, "It is typically said that 20 kids can't play together for a long time and the main thing consistent in life is change. We are all still companions and there are no hard emotions between us. He just chose to accomplish something else and we completely bolster him." 

For the individuals who may not know, the gathering, Styl, as they were at first known, was shaped in 1997 by Shifi Emoefe, Tunde Akinsanmi, Yemi Akinwunmi, and Lanre Faneyi as a gospel band. Nonetheless, Lanre passed away a few years after the fact and Zeal joined the group.
